More on the Afghan rampager who ran over 14 people in San Franciso
2006-08-31
Hattip Gateway Pundit, who has a nice little round up on the subject, with photos and a map.

Omeed Aziz Popal, now in custody for a fatal hit-and-run rampage that apparently began in Fremont and ended in San Francisco, has a history of mental problems and suffered an apparent mental breakdown Tuesday on the way to a job interview, family members and his attorney said Tuesday.

But those involved in the investigation -- speaking on condition of anonymity -- discount any mental illness, saying the 29-year-old Afghanistan native seemed coherent, unrepentant and claimed that he repeatedly drove at pedestrians because he "just wanted to.'' According to his attorney, Majeed Samara, Popal suffered a breakdown about five months ago and had to be hospitalized. "He woke up and started freaking out,'' he said. The family took Popal to Kaiser Permanente Medical Center in Fremont for treatment, but he was released. "It looks like he felt better, but after that, he started getting worse.''

About two months ago, Popal falsely confessed to killing someone in San Francisco, Samara said. He said Popal was interviewed by investigators in Fremont and his statement turned out to be a "John Karr confession,'' referring to the man recently released in the killing of 6-year-old JonBenet Ramsey.

Popal's prior contact with law enforcement, authorities say, amounted to a string of four traffic tickets in Fremont and separate minor citations in Pleasanton and Palo Alto since 2003. He was twice cited for driving in carpool lanes. He was also twice cited on seat belt violations, once for an unsafe lane change and once for going beyond the limit line. He also had a dismissed citation for speeding out of Turlock in Stanislaus County last year. A month ago, the one-time autoworker returned home after getting married in his native Afghanistan, his family said. There was a wedding celebration two weeks ago. Homa Aziz, a cousin who lives in Hayward, said that Popal, who was studying auto mechanics at WyoTech, formerly known as the Sequoia Institute, intended to bring his wife from Afghanistan to settle in the area. Hamid Nekrawesh, another cousin, said that he joked with Popal before he went to Kabul about him becoming a man.

On Tuesday, Nekrawesh said, Popal was to go to an interview for a job with an employment agency in San Francisco.

Neighbors in Fremont recalled that Popal also had worked for New United Motor Manufacturing Inc. auto plant in Fremont, which manufactures Toyotas and Pontiacs. They said he lived there with his parents, two sisters and brother in a middle-class neighborhood on Cabrillo Drive in Fremont. Neighbors say the family lived on Cabrillo Drive for three years and was known for frequent garage sales in which they would sell everything from DVDs to household appliances.
